2.One D.R.Kousik Devatha Ragunath is setting up a solar plant in Kumulur Village. He appears to have sourced the lands from one Ragurammoorthy and others. The allegation made by the writ petitioners is that in the guise of setting up the solar plant, D.R.Kousik Devatha Ragunath has obliterated the cart tracks and also water bodies. With the aforesaid allegations, these two writ petitions have been filed.

3.In W.P(MD)No.24276 of 2024, the prayer is that the petition mentioned survey numbers should not be declassified. Survey Numbers are as follows:

"Survey Nos. 571, 572/1, 572/2, 574/4, 575/1, 577, 579, 598/2, 602/3, 604/1, 604/2, 605, 606, 608/1, 610/1, 610/4, 610/5, 610/9, 611/2, 611/4, 612/6 and 746, situated at Kumulur village, Lalgudi Taluk, Tiruchirapalli District." After hearing both sides, we have to make the following remarks in respect of each of the aforesaid survey numbers:

"Survey No.571 is admitted to be a water body and according to the official respondents, there are no encroachments therein.

In Survey No.572/1, Vibrant Excon Private Limited and Ragurammoorthy have no claim in this survey number. Survey Nos.574/4, 575/1 have been classified as cart track and it is intact. Vibrant Excon Private Limited and Ragurammoorthy have no claim in these survey numbers. Survey Nos.577, 579 have been classified as cart track. Survey No.598/2 has been classified as water body and Vibrant Excon Private Limited and Raguramamoorthy have no claim in this survey number.

Survey Nos.604/1, 610/1, 611/4 have been classified as cart track.

Survey Nos.604/2, 605, 610/9, 611/2, 612/6 continues to be Tharisu land even as on date.

Survey Nos.606, 746 have been classified as water body. Survey No.608/1 has been classified as water body / cart track.

Survey Nos.610/4, 610/5 are patta lands. Vibrant Excon Private Limited and Raguramamoorthy have no claim in these survey numbers.

Ragurammoorthy who is the eighth respondent in WP(MD)No.24276 of 2024 has made it clear that he has claim only over Survey No.602/3 and not on any other survey number. Survey No.602/3 was originally classified as Government land. But patta has been issued in favour of Raguramamoorthy. We wanted to know from the learned Government counsel as to whether any assignment was made in respect of Survey No.602/3. He categorically states that no assignment order was ever made. In that event, an enquiry will have to be done as to how patta stood in the name of Raguramamoorthy. Chinnadurai 6/10

and Meganathan, the petitioners herein undertake to submit formal petitions in this regard before the District Revenue Officer, Trichy District within a period of two weeks from the date of receipt of copy of this order. The District Revenue Officer, Trichy District is directed to issue notice to Raguramamoorthy and other interested persons and pass a speaking order on merits and in accordance with law within a period of three months thereafter. Till the said enquiry is completed, no further development activity shall take place in Survey No.602/3.

4.In W.P(MD)No.5364 of 2024, what is under challenge is the memorandum dated 11.02.2024 issued by the Revenue Divisional Officer, Lalgudi. It encompasses as many as 12 survey numbers. According to the petitioner, 4 out of 12 survey numbers are water bodies. We are of the view that the memorandum issued by the Revenue Divisional Officer, Lalgudi is very much amenable to challenge before the District Revenue Officer, Trichy. The petitioner herein also point out that there are features of Archeological importance in the vicinity. We therefore called upon the Archeological Survey of India to conduct field inspection and submit a report. The report of the Archeological Survey of India is under:

"Conclusion:

The temple remains mentioned above were destroyed more than 100 years ago. Though all of these unprotected sites have archaeological importance, they do not throw light or mark on any important event in the history and culture of the region at National level. However, owing to its local importance the respective villagers along with the help of the local authorities, should take care of them. The loose sculptures, architectural members, and inscriptions from these sites have to be shifted to the district museum of Trichy, for their safety, after taking the consent of the respective villages."

5.These Writ Petitions are disposed of accordingly. There shall be no order as to costs. Consequently, connected miscellaneous petitions are closed.
